Classic Top & Bottom Meme Template
A familiar two-caption structure that sets up the context above an image and lands the reaction or punchline below it.
When this layout works
- Fast reaction memes
- Simple setup-and-payoff jokes
- Photos with a clear subject in the middle
Choose an image with open space near the top and bottom so the subject remains visible between the captions.

Edit and export it cleanly
Keep both lines short and move them inward if a social app may crop the outer edge.
- 1. Open the layout. The editor loads its starter structure and text layers from the deep link.
- 2. Add your own image if needed. Upload, paste, or drop a PNG, JPG, or WebP; adjust crop position, rotation, flips, darkness, and blur locally.
- 3. Choose the destination ratio. Keep the starting ratio or switch to square, portrait, Pinterest, landscape, or story before final text placement.
- 4. Export once. PNG is the safest default for crisp outlined text; JPG and WebP are also available.
